Split Buns with Cream and Jam – soft, enriched y Split Buns with Cream and Jam – soft, enriched yeast buns split and filled with fresh whipped cream and raspberry jam, then dusted with powdered sugar!

Once again, The Great British Baking Show has led me to a new treat I'd never heard of but was completely entranced by! Devonshire split buns are a popular British treat made with soft baked buns filled with cream and jam, and honestly? I'm obsessed! 

What I love about these buns is how they feel like eating a sweet sandwich – imagine a jam sandwich but in a long bun with whipped cream! Doesn't that make you drool?

The great news is they're super easy to make! With a simple enriched dough recipe and store-bought jam, you can have these buns ready in just a couple of hours! The dough took me some time to develop because I wanted them soft like hot dog buns (but obviously sweeter!), not dense and heavy!

Pro tip: DO NOT slice all the way through! Leave the bottom connected so the buns hold the filling well! Use piping bags with tips to fill neatly – it makes them look bakery-quality!

Perfect for breakfast, dessert, holiday gatherings, brunch, or anytime you want a soft, indulgent treat!

Fig & Goat Cheese Crostini – crispy baguette sli Fig & Goat Cheese Crostini – crispy baguette slices rubbed with fresh garlic, spread with rosemary honey goat cheese, and topped with fig preserves! 

This particular crostini was born when I had leftover fig preserves to use up! And let me tell you – this combination is INCREDIBLE! Every single bite is perfectly balanced – crispy, tangy, sweet, spicy, and creamy all at once! My guests absolutely cannot stop at just one!

The magic is in the rosemary honey goat cheese spread – that's where all the flavor comes from! The fresh rosemary pairs SO beautifully with the sweet fig preserves!
Pro tip: Do NOT assemble these until you're ready to serve! 

The bread will get soggy if you make them ahead! BUT you can toast the bread and make the goat cheese spread ahead of time for quick assembly!

Perfect for holiday parties, entertaining guests, or anytime you need an impressive appetizer that's seriously easy to make! 🎉
